PROFESSOR LUISI. “In 1985 Luisi founded the "Cortona Week", an international, interdisciplinary summer school, under the general title "Sciences and the Wholeness of Life" - targeted mostly for graduate students and young managers, with the aim of forming a new class of society leaders, aware of the new frontiers of science, and also of the ecology, ethics and spirituality of life.” https://en.m.wikipedia.org/wiki/Pier_Luigi_Luisi View in LinkedIn

Pier Luigi Luisi (born 23 May 1938) graduated in chemistry from the Scuola Normale Superiore di Pisa, and is an Italian Professor Emeritus from the ETHZ, the Swiss Federal Institute of Technology, where he worked as a scientist from 1970 till 2003 - as full professor in chemistry since 1980 - to move then to the university of Rome as Professor of Biochemistry, till 2015.” https://en.m.wikipedia.org/wiki/Pier_Luigi_Luisi View in LinkedIn
